METODE HPLC-DAD UNTUK ANALISIS GLUKOSAMIN PADA TERIPANG KERING DENGAN DERIVATISASI PREKOLOM (HPLC-DAD Method for Glucosamine Analysis in Dried Sea Cucumber with Precolumn Derivatization)

SUMMARY

 Glucosamine is known to be a supplement for treating osteoarthritis and joint pain. Recently, Indonesian coastal communities have developed sea cucumber enriched in glucosamine as an alternative to crustaceans, a widely consumed-glucosamine source. The aim of this study is to develop a high performance liquid chromatography tandem with diode array detector (HPLC-DAD) method for the determination of glucosamine in sea cucumber products was developed and validated. Glucosamine were extracted from dried sea cucumber samples through hydrolysis using hydrochloric acid 5 M, followed by derivatization using Fmoc-Cl (9-Fluorenylmethyl chloroformate) and borate buffer before subjected to HPLC-DAD. All preparation steps for samples and standards were performed using the gravimetric dilution method. The reversed-phase chromatographic separation was conducted in the C18 column by applying a gradient elution of water and acetonitrile. The results showed good linearity with coefficient determination at 0.999 in the range concentration of 1-220 mg/kg. The LOD and LOQ were found to be 0.16 and 0.53 mg/kg respectively, while the recoveries were in the range of 98-99%. The intraday precision values were lower than 2% for four different spiked concentrations (10, 60, 100, and 200 mg/kg). The method then successfully applied to analyze glucosamine in twenty local dried sea cucumber samples. The results showed that eleven of samples contain glucosamine in the range of 100 to 2700 mg/kg.Keywords: fmoc-cl, glucosamine, hplc-dad, sea cucumberABSTRAKGlukosamin dikenal sebagai suplemen untuk mengobati osteoartritis dan nyeri sendi.
